What is a LazyField?

Nov 9, 2010 at 1:52 AM

Just looking at writing a module and reviewing some code.

I came accross a Lazy field declared on line 7 of /Modules/Orchard.ArchiveLater/Models/ArchiveLaterPart.cs.

I did a search on orchardprojects.net/docs and found zip.

So what is it?

Nov 9, 2010 at 3:54 AM

It's a fairly common practice that enables the class using it to only evaluate the property value the first time it's required.